Explain the two theological problems of Canto IV and how Dante addresses them. Your answer should be at least one hundred words.
Iteru [2.4K]
In Canto IV, Dante is informed of how people who lived before the time of Jesus Christ are forced to spend the rest of their eternal after lives. He is told that they are stuck in limbo, and cannot be pulled from their grueling state. Dante weeps because he realizes it is unfair; those people did not have the option to follow Jesus Christ and be baptised into christianity.
